You shouldn't kiss or touch a frog

LOS ANGELES (AP) - April 20, 2011

In real life, touching them can kill the creatures and cause serious problems for humans, too.

April is National Frog Month.

The head of the Turtle Back Zoo in New Jersey says while most people probably know that touching frogs and toads won't give you warts, frogs can transmit diseases.

He says they can give humans tapeworm cysts and salmonella poisoning.

Both can cause serious complications if not treated quickly.
